The Eastern Suburbs' coastal setting positions unique challenges for electrical systems, highlighting the importance of a certified Level 2 ASP Electrician in Bondi for ensuring the integrity and safety of regional electrical connections. Although a routine electrician can deal with jobs such as internal electrical wiring and outlet installations, just a Level 2 Accredited Service Provider is lawfully allowed to deal with the external network that supplies electricity. As a result, for any job needing a connection or disconnection from the Ausgrid-managed grid, the know-how of a Level 2 ASP Electrician in Bondi is important for carrying out the complex and high-risk jobs involved. The technical services offered by a Level 2 ASP Electrician Bondi are categorised into unique classes that attend to the most crucial elements of a home's energy supply, beginning with the setup and maintenance of overhead and underground service lines. In a suburban area where salt spray and high winds are constant aspects, a Level 2 ASP Electrician Bondi must pay particular attention to the integrity of point-of-attachment brackets and fascia boards, as seaside deterioration can rapidly lead to harmful electrical faults. For many homeowners wanting to modernise their homes, a Level 2 ASP Electrician Bondi is regularly called upon to perform a three-phase power upgrade, which is necessary for supporting the high energy demands of ducted air conditioning, fast-charging stations for electrical cars, and premium kitchen devices. This upgrade involves replacing the existing consumer mains and ensuring the service fuse is robust enough to handle the increased load without running the risk of a fire or a system failure. Level 2 ASP Electrician Bondi plays a vital function in handling sophisticated metering services, specifically in the shift towards smarter energy monitoring and increased use of renewable resource sources in the region. These certified professionals are in charge of setting up and setting up digital clever meters that use real-time data to assist homes and businesses in efficiently managing their energy usage. When it comes to setting up panels, it is necessary for a Level 2 ASP Electrician Bondi to guarantee that the metering system is appropriately set up for solar net or gross metering, enabling accurate tracking of energy returned to the circulation network. Furthermore, these electricians are the bottom line of contact for addressing electrical flaw notifications from network inspectors. In cases where a home has non-compliant service wiring or an outdated switchboard posing dangers to the grid, a Level 2 ASP Electrician Bondi need to be engaged promptly to correct the problem, making sure constant power supply and acquiring a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work for all repairs.
